SUMMARY:

The Director of People Operations is a strategic, systems-driven leader responsible for building, optimizing, and scaling HR across a multi-site charter school network. This role ensures operational excellence, regulatory compliance, and high-integrity data systems while enabling effective, decentralized hiring across school leaders. As a member of the executive team, this leader reports to the CFO and partners with the Chief of Staff to drive talent strategy, strengthen organizational effectiveness, and support sustainable growth across the organization.

 

ABOUT THE ROLE:

This role is designed for a tech-savvy, detail-oriented leader who thrives at the intersection of systems, data, and people. You will own and optimize the HR technology ecosystem, streamline processes across the employee lifecycle, and serve as the operational backbone supporting 5 superintendents and 17 principals in hiring and managing their teams.

Once a strong operational foundation is in place, you will partner with executive leadership to implement a formal leadership development program that strengthens administrator effectiveness, retention, and internal mobility.

 

WHAT YOU'LL DO:

Optimize HR Strategy
Own and optimize the HR technology ecosystem (JazzHR, Frontline, ADP), maximizing automation, reporting, and system capabilities to streamline onboarding, offboarding, benefits administration, and licensure tracking.

Support Talent Acquisition Strategy
Support a decentralized hiring model by equipping superintendents and principals with tools, processes, and guidance while serving as the final quality checkpoint. Evaluate and implement predictive hiring tools to improve candidate selection and efficiency.

Leverage Data
Ensure accurate, clean, and integrated HR data across systems. Leverage insights to inform decision-making, improve workflows, and strengthen organizational effectiveness.

Lead the HR Team
Lead and develop the HR Coordinator and HR Assistant(s) to ensure seamless day-to-day operations. Partner with HR contractors to bring best practices in HR and organizational effectiveness.

Collaborate Cross-Functionally
Collaborate with the Treasurer and Accounting team on payroll and financial integration, and with the Chief of Staff on employee lifecycle management and disciplinary processes.

Ensure Compliance
Maintain adherence to all federal, state, and K-12 regulatory requirements, including BG checks, licensure, and employment practices.

Drive HR Strategy
Refine and standardize HR processes and SOPs. Partner with executive leadership to align HR strategy with organizational priorities and growth objectives.

Develop Leaders
Launch a structured leadership development program for school leaders and central office staff to strengthen capability, retention, and succession planning.

WHAT WE'RE LOOKING FOR:

  • 8+ years of progressive HR experience, with focus on operations, HRIS management, and systems optimization.
  • Hands-on experience with HRIS platforms such as JazzHR, Frontline, ADP, or similar systems.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age and analyze HR data to drive decisions.
  • Experience evaluating and implementing HR technology solutions, including AI-based or predictive hiring tools.
  • Proven success improving compliance, workflows, and processes in a multi-site or 500+ employee organization.
  • Experience leading and developing team members.
  • Ability to coach, influence, and support decentralized leaders.
  • K-12 education or charter school experience is a plus.
  • Leadership development or training program experience is a plus.

 

Work Schedule: Monday-Friday, daytime hours, (with occasional flexibility).

Physical Requirements: Primarily sedentary, including extended computer use, with standing, walking, and light lifting as needed. Occasional travel may be required.

 

WHY JOIN US?

Our client is a growing charter school network, with 17 school sites across Ohio, serving nearly 4,000 students and employing 500+ professionals. As the organization continues to scale, this role offers a unique opportunity to modernize HR systems, standardize data, and elevate the organization's talent strategy, directly impacting both staff and student success.
